PEOPLE'S PLACE II INC, founded in 1972, is a community nonprofit in the Human Services sector that reported $8.0M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024.

Mission

PEOPLE'S PLACE II, INC. IS DEDICATED TO BECOMING THE AGENCY OF CHOICE TO HELP PEOPLE FIND THEIR PATH TO GROWTH AND INDEPENDENCE.
